I found out that my local grocer's cashes any checks written to me if they are local.

If it is a tax refund or large check from someone out of state, I can usually go to Pay Day place, and although I don't like the 2.5% I am charged, at least I have my money. And they treat you very nicely - unlike the banks, where they can be positively snotty.

Banks want you to get a $ 20 checking account, and then they make you wait three days for the money. I just want my money.
